26 lines
583 B
Groovy
26 lines
583 B
Groovy
plugins {
|
|
id "io.spring.convention.docs"
|
|
}
|
|
|
|
asciidoctor {
|
|
attributes([
|
|
"spring-authorization-server-version": project.version,
|
|
"spring-security-reference-base-url": "https://docs.spring.io/spring-security/reference",
|
|
"spring-security-api-base-url": "https://docs.spring.io/spring-security/site/docs/current/api",
|
|
"examples-dir": "examples",
|
|
"docs-java": "$sourceDir/examples/src/main/java",
|
|
"chomp": "default headers packages",
|
|
"toc": "left",
|
|
"toclevels": "4"
|
|
])
|
|
}
|
|
|
|
docsZip {
|
|
from (api) {
|
|
into "api"
|
|
}
|
|
from(asciidoctor) {
|
|
into "reference/html"
|
|
}
|
|
}
|